Quite frankly with .22s no two even if identical mean they will like the same ammo. I would just buy a few boxes of standard velocity or target ammo to see what it likes best. Stay away from the hyper or high velocity and you will see you best groups.

CCI Green Tag, Wolf Match Target or Federal Gold Medal would three good rounds to try in the rifle. Chances are if it will not deliver satisfactory groups with one of those three choices there is an issue with the rifle.

Picked one up this year. It loves CCI Stingers. Shoots CCI mini mags (not the ones with Troy Landry), CCI standard velocity and Norma Match pretty good. I know the CCI mini mags with Troy and the mini mags without look the same. But they do not shoot the same in any of the 3 rifles we shot this summer. Also if you go to the Nikon Spot on calculator it list them as separate bullets with different BC. I shot 22 more this summer than I ever have and I absolutely loved it.

I have gotten into .22 more this year as well. Looking for more than MOS (minuet of squirrel) and boy did I get an education. I got a CZ American in .22 lr and started shooting some internet matches and found that I had to bump up my ammo game just to be on the same page with the good shooters. Right now, I'm shooting SK Standard + because I haven't reached the potential of the ammo yet before moving up to the really accurate stuff. And the old adage still proves true as it did with cars. If you want to go fast, spend more money. If you chase accuracy, spend more money. LOL. The SK Std. + is $.10/rd. The better stuff is around $.25/rd. and the really good stuff is as high as $.45/rd.

One of the nice things about .22 ammo is that there's a good chance to find an ammo that your rifle will really shoot well. When you find that ammo buy a case (5,000 rounds) of the ammo for future use. Get the same lot number if possible.
